ZonePlayer ZP100 Front

On/Off

Using the Sonos Controller, select
Pause All from the Zone menu.

Using the Desktop Controller software,
select Pause All from the Play menu.

Your Sonos Digital Music System is designed to be always
on; the system uses minimal electricity whenever it is not
playing music. To stop streaming music in all zones, you
can use the Pause All feature.

ZonePlayer status indicator

Flashes white when powering up or
connecting to your Sonos Digital Music
System.

Solid white when powered up and
connected to your Sonos Digital Music
System (normal operation).

Indicates the current status of the ZonePlayer. When the
ZonePlayer is in normal operation, you can turn the white
status indicator light on and off. For additional
information, see the online help system included with
your Desktop Controller software.

Mute button

Lights solid green when sound is muted.

Flashes green rapidly when household
mute or unmute is about to take place.

Flashes green slowly when ZonePlayer is
connecting to your music system.

To mute/unmute this ZonePlayer: Press the Mute
button to mute or unmute this ZonePlayer.
To mute/unmute all ZonePlayers: Press and hold the
Mute button for 3 seconds to mute all ZonePlayers in your
household. Press and hold for 3 seconds to unmute all
ZonePlayers.

Volume up (+)

Volume down (-)

Press these buttons to adjust the volume up and down.
